The Leatherman Raptor Folding Shears are a compact, multi-functional tool designed for emergency professionals and everyday users alike. With a durable carbide construction, these shears feature a glass breaker, strap cutter, and a MOLLE compatible holster, making them an essential addition to any toolkit. Backed by a 25-year warranty, they are built to withstand the test of time.

After 35 Years, The Best Trauma Shear Cutting Action I've Ever Seen
Absolutely incredible. At first, I was hesitant to buy this pricey item in that, with 35 years experience in using Trauma Shears, I imagined it was just another player late in the game producing a featureless but steadfast money making item of the rescue world. Given all the Leatherman's type of "Swiss Army" features, I first thought it to be first aider's belt trinket, attractive only to rescue wannabees...I was wrong.After using this thing just once, I was immediately stunned by how frighteningly powerful these shears are. Yes, regular trauma shears are great in that, if you hold them at just the right angle and there is just the right tension on the cloth; one can effortlessly slide the blade of the shears across the material and make an impressively long cut. But the problem with this technique is that once the material bunches or folds up in an uncooperative way that counters the "perfect" angle, the blade cutting action comes to a grinding halt and one needs to employ the scissoring action of the shears. It is at this point that common shears fail and the Raptor shines. I was cutting through one patient's shirt and it had gathered up; anticipating at least several furious passes to break through the mass of coiled fabric I was stunned when it was done with two simple snips. The Leatherman literally took HUGE bites and never slipped or choked on the cloth. Curiously intrigued by this, I purposely repeated the same type of cutting action by grabbing a section of the patient's pants, pulling them down to just above the knee (where an IO line was already placed); the material was now gathered into a miniature log of fabric wet with saline in my hand; Snip, snip, snip... done! Another caregiver (who was attending the code alongside with me) witnessed approvingly of the ease of the Raptor's cut by saying out loud, "...damn, that thing is sharp."Afterwards, I closely examined the blades on the Raptor and found them to be heavier and thicker than regular shear blades; one side is also tightly serrated which I suppose allowed it to dig into the material and not slip at all. Nicely done. The inclusion of the Strap Cutter, Ring Cutter, Glass Punch and O2 Wrench Key, along the the Non Slip Holster makes this a very versatile "must have" on any rescue worker's belt.The only down side is the many moving parts of the folding action, which necessitates tremendously tedious attention and care in cleaning. If heavily contaminated with blood or body fluids, I would recommend first bagging the item if you need to travel, and at your earliest opportunity, rinsing the thing in plain water. Thereafter a complete immersion and soaking in a disinfectant bath while working the actions of the various mechanical parts is in order, to ensure a thorough cleaning. There are also two spring action buttons (one on either side, which allows the shear to fold into itself) which may entrap infectious material that is almost impossible to clean unless one uses an autoclave. Once disinfected, thoroughly dry the item before replacement back into the holster. BTW, the Non Slip Holster is exactly that. The Raptor can even be held upside down in the directionally adjustable holster and it will not fall out.Overall, in it's primary function, that of cutting through clothes in an emergency situation, this is the best I've seen after a lifetime of emergency care. Easy Five Stars.

Excellent Shears
I'll admit that I was a bit hesitant at first to spend $100 on a pair of trauma shears that I get for free at work. I'm a firefighter/EMT and use these often. Someone at work had this same leatherman tool and I got to use his first hand. I was impressed. Not only are they stronger and will outlast the free shears, but they fold up and has other handy uses that just make this pair of shears more personal. Well, I broke down and ordered my own and I'm glad that I did. I've already used them for miscellaneous reasons around my house. They re lubricated to make use simple and I already love mine! The belt holster is also pretty cool. I wasn't going to use it at first because I thought it would be too bulky, but I tried it on and its more convenient to fold up my shears and slide them in the clip for safer storage instead of my pocket. I'll get great use out of the O2 wrench and seatbelt cutter i no time, The ring cutter as a bit on the thin side, but I'm sure with 2 quick cuts I'll be able to get a rind off someone in need with ease until the man vrs machine tools get on scene. Love my shears!
